Delphi OleVariant 类型的用法
2016-06-28 20:12
267 查看
因客户需求,对客户的指纹机与公司产品进行集成,需要对指纹机做接口的二次开发,郁闷的是产商只提供了VB和C的DEMO示例,没有Delphi的,公司没有VB,C的环境,不能打开这二种语言的示例,因为本公司搭环境特麻烦,加上之前做过类似的开发,所以也懒得去搭环境了,按照以前的开发经验写了个DEMO进行测试,一路进行得很顺利,但到了下载用户指纹和上传用户指纹数据时卡住了,因为下载用户指纹时,用于获取指纹数据传入到接口函数中的参数类型是OleVariant类型的,返回后变成了 Variant array of Integer类型了。这里碰到二个问题了:
1、如何从OleVariant类型的数组中赋值取值
2、指纹数据放在了一个数组中,我如何把这些数据保存到数据库和很方便的从数据库取出来
一直以为OleVariant很复杂,在网上搜了很多资料,终于发现OleVariant类型数组赋值和取值其实很简单,如下:
取值:
赋值:
是不是很简单了呢?
http://www.vckbase.com/module/articleContent.php?id=4359
1、如何从OleVariant类型的数组中赋值取值
2、指纹数据放在了一个数组中,我如何把这些数据保存到数据库和很方便的从数据库取出来
一直以为OleVariant很复杂,在网上搜了很多资料,终于发现OleVariant类型数组赋值和取值其实很简单,如下:
取值:
http://www.vckbase.com/module/articleContent.php?id=4359
相关文章推荐
- 在VC6.0下如何调用Delphi5.0开发的进程内COM
- 如何在Delphi中调用VC6.0开发的COM
- delphi调用C#webservice接口的中文编码问题
- 使用delphi 开发多层应用(二)为什么要使用多层开发?
- 使用delphi 开发多层应用(三)Delphi常用多层框架介绍
- 我常用的delphi 第三方控件
- Delphi反汇编内部字符串处理函数/过程不完全列表
- ACCESS技巧集(DELPHI AND SQL)
- delphi数据库存储图片
- Delphi xe FireMonkey FMX StingGrid 点击表头排序
- Delphi中inherited问题
- delphi 获取cmd命令返回并显示(笔记)
- delphi 文件拖拽获取路径(二)支持多文件(笔记)
- delphi 文件拖拽获取路径(一)支持单文件(笔记)
- 扩展IDE——为翻译OC头文件增加编写模板OCImport
- delphi制作资源文件(二)一个A.exe释放出B.exe 并且修改b.exe变量的值
- delphi制作资源文件(一)一个A.exe释放出B.exe
- Delphi XE10支持IOS IPV6的处理
- Delphi XE10调用百度地图和百度导航
- delphi 快捷键